Output b86bf2d3e8100076ddbfbf823c984a92368d9b49c0bf6c0598f1ef3eea8f55d6:15

value
1274465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84984e1c4ecc3e443c7a0a5bcacdf350b4927071 OP_EQUAL
address
3Dn7aDAg7NFo8bxEYLKpmL9m94XAWXanNA
transaction
b86bf2d3e8100076ddbfbf823c984a92368d9b49c0bf6c0598f1ef3eea8f55d6
confirmations
210943
spent
true